LAKELAND, Fla. — M. Clayton Hollis Jr., vice president of public affairs at Publix Super Markets here, plans to retire at the end of the year, a spokeswoman for the chain told SN Monday.

Hollis’ areas of responsibility include media and communications, government relations, corporate communications, customer care and social media. He has been with the employee-owned company for 40 years. A successor has not yet been identified, the spokeswoman, Maria Brous, told SN.

Hollis’ father, Mark C. Hollis, retired as president of the company in 1996.
